Things of the Earth

About The Book

<p>It is 1954 and Barton Barre has not only survived World War II but also come home a hero thanks to his family’s lucky phoenix. However for this man of action fortune is as fickle as is his heart. Now as he works to build a Texas oil empire he must also keep his beautiful wife Elise and their son Francis content. Unfortunately for Barton this challenge is not easy as temptation and greed influence his every move.</p><p>Elise is a devoted mother who also faithfully follows Barton despite his callousness and lies. She knows his soul and believes he is the beast that only her love can tame.</p><p>Francis is a resilient boy who has learned early that when it comes to his father he comes last. As he matures strives for perfection and exceeds his parents’ expectations Francis still manages to fall into the shadow of their demanding lives. As temptation knocks on his own door life leads Francis down a new path where every decision comes with consequences and he ponders whether he is now a victim of the dreaded La Barre family curse.</p><p>In this continuing multi-generational tale fate and luck play havoc with the Barre family during post-World War II Texas where love appears to be the only key to bliss.</p>
